PRON-REFL You use themselves to refer to people, animals, or things when the object of a verb or preposition refers to the same people or things as the subject of the verb. 他們自己; 她們自己; 它們自己[v PRON, prep PRON] They all seemed to be enjoying themselves. 他們看起來都玩得很愉快。2. PRON-REFL-EMPH You use themselves to emphasize the people or things that you are referring to. Themselves is also sometimes used instead of "them" as the object of a verb or preposition. (用于強(qiáng)調(diào),或代替賓格“他們”) 他們自己; 她們自己; 它們自己[強(qiáng)調(diào)] Many mentally ill people are themselves unhappy about the idea of community care. 許多精神病患者自身不喜歡社區(qū)護(hù)理。3. PRON-REFL You use themselves instead of "himself or herself" to refer back to the person who is the subject of the sentence without saying whether it is a man or a woman. Some people think this use is incorrect. 用于代替“他自己”或“她自己”,指代句子的主語,不指明是男是女,有些人認(rèn)為這種用法不正確[v PRON, prep PRON] What can a patient with emphysema do to help themselves? 肺氣腫的病人能做些什么來自助?4. PRON-REFL-EMPH You use themselves instead of "himself or herself" to emphasize the person you are referring to without saying whether it is a man or a woman. Themselves is also sometimes used as the object of a verb or preposition.
